對于初學者來說,選擇一款適合的C語言編譯器是邁向編程世界的重要一步。在眾多的選擇中,應該如何找到最適合初學者的C語言編譯器呢?本文將通過具體實例來說明幾款適合初學者的C語言編譯器,幫助你選擇合適的編程起點。
C語言是一門廣泛應用于系統(tǒng)編程和嵌入式開發(fā)的高效編程語言,雖然它在文字輸出方面相對簡約,但我們可以通過一些技巧和庫來賦予C語言的輸出以色彩,使文字更加漂亮。本文將介紹如何實現(xiàn)彩色版的C語言輸出,讓你的文字在終端或命令行中展現(xiàn)出炫麗的效果。
在Java的面試中,廣度優(yōu)先搜索(BFS)是常見的算法思想之一。BFS用于解決圖遍歷、最短路徑和狀態(tài)轉(zhuǎn)換等問題。本文將介紹一道經(jīng)典的Java面試題——廣度優(yōu)先搜索,并提供詳細的解析和解題思路。
在學習編程之前,一些人可能會擔心自己英語和數(shù)學不好會成為學習的障礙。然而,我要告訴你,即使英語和數(shù)學不是你的強項,你仍然可以學習和掌握編程。本文將通過具體實例說明如何克服這些困難,并開啟你的編程之旅。
在Java的面試中,深度優(yōu)先搜索(DFS)是常見的算法思想之一。DFS用于解決圖遍歷、路徑搜索和組合問題等。本文將介紹一道經(jīng)典的Java面試題——深度優(yōu)先搜索,并提供詳細的解析和解題思路。
在當今數(shù)字化時代,編程已成為一項重要的技能,涉及到各個行業(yè)和領域。對于許多高中畢業(yè)生來說,他們可能會疑惑,高中畢業(yè)后是否足夠?qū)W會編程?本文將探討這個問題,并通過具體實例說明高中畢業(yè)生可以學會編程的可能性和途徑。
在Java的面試中,算法問題是常見的考察內(nèi)容之一。零一背包問題是經(jīng)典的動態(tài)規(guī)劃問題,涉及到優(yōu)化資源利用的背包選擇。本文將介紹一道經(jīng)典的Java面試題——零一背包問題,并提供詳細的解析和解題思路。
在Java的面試中,算法題是常見的考察內(nèi)容之一。解決算法問題需要靈活的思維和良好的編程能力。本文將介紹一道經(jīng)典的Java面試題——兩數(shù)之和(Two Sum),并提供詳細的解析和解題思路。
學習編程語言時,通過解決習題可以幫助鞏固知識和提升技能。對于正在學習或想要提升 C++ 編程能力的人來說,一個好的習題庫至關重要。本文將介紹幾個值得推薦的 C++ 習題庫,并通過具體實例來說明它們的特點和適用場景。